> +- Method naming?
It usually pays to make the questions more explicit and exact.
This is a broad question that doesn't specify what is needed to answer it.
For example
- How should the method that does X in interface Y be named?
fooBar or barFoo?
and only have those for the ones that you are uncertain of, or ones
that others have raised issues for.
